The MGC68 MP40 is a wonderful modelgun to have, one of the best really. One word of caution though... you say it'll fire Blanks... make absolutely sure that it has been converted to fire Blank ammunition before attempting to do so.
As standard, MGC68 MP40s are designed and built to fire cap loaded re-useable brass cartridges.
These produce far less power when fired than a Blank round. If you were to try firing a blank round there is every likelyhood you'll destroy the modelgun and possibly injure yourself and/or others seriously.

Real and model MP40s fired in Full Auto mode only. They fire relatively slowly, between 500-650 rds per minute and with practice careful trigger use can give controlled bursts of 2,3,5 or any number up to a magazine full if it's set up properly.

If you've any doubts at all, please post up some photos of your MP40, particularly the chamber, bolt, barrel and upper receiver. A well-converted Blank Firer will be significantly reinforced and have steel working parts, not Zinc Alloy.

We've seen several PFC modelguns advertised Worldwide recently described as Blank Fire when they are definately not... please be careful and absolutely certain what you have before you attempt to fire it.
